Typical Signs Your Double-Glazed Door Needs Repair
Recognizing the early indication of a stopping working double-glazed door can conserve property owners hundreds of pounds in prospective replacements and escalating energy costs. Here are the most regular indications that a window repair near is required:
- Condensation Between the Panes: If moisture types inside the glass unit, the hermetic seal has failed, enabling humid air to get in the cavity.
- Drafts and Cold Spots: Feeling a breeze around the frame suggests the weatherstripping has actually broken down or the door has moved out of positioning.
- Trouble Locking or Unlocking: This typically points to a misaligned frame, a failing multipoint locking mechanism, or a distorted door.
- Sticking or Door repairman Dragging: If the door scrapes versus the flooring or frame when opening and closing, the hinges have most likely slipped or used down.
- Visible Frame Damage: Cracks, rot (in wood frames), or warping (in uPVC frames) can compromise both security and thermal efficiency.

Can You DIY Double-Glazed Door Repairs?
While the DIY movement has actually empowered house owners to deal with different home tasks, double-glazed doors are complicated systems. Here is a breakdown of what can securely be done in your home versus what needs a professional.
Safe DIY Tasks:
- Hinges Adjustment: Most uPVC and composite door hinges have change screws concealed beneath plastic caps. Tightening or loosening up these can fix small sagging or sticking.
- Lubrication: Applying a silicone-based spray or graphite powder to locks, hinges, and tracks keeps systems running efficiently. Do not use heavy oils or grease, as they draw in dust and grit.
- Replacing Handles: If a handle is loose or damaged, changing it is usually a simple matter of loosening the faceplate and swapping it out.
Tasks Best Left to Professionals:
- Replacing the Sealed Glass Unit: This requires specialized suction cups, removing the glazing beads without breaking them, and making sure the new unit is properly shimmed and sealed.
- Mechanism Replacements: Multipoint locking systems are intricate. Setting up a replacement transmission requires precise alignment to make sure the door stays secure.
- Structural Realignment: If a door has distorted substantially due to structure shifts or severe temperature exposure, a professional can properly re-square the frame.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. The length of time do double-glazed doors normally last?
Premium double-glazed doors generally last in between 20 to 35 years. However, moving parts like locks, manages, and seals may require servicing, adjusting, or changing every 5 to 10 years to preserve optimal performance.
2. Can you fix a "misted" double-glazed door without changing the glass?
While there are some DIY kits and business that claim to drill holes and clear out misted systems, these are normally momentary fixes. To restore the thermal insulation completely, the insulated glass system (IGU) should be replaced. Fortunately, you only change the glass, not the entire frame.
3. Why is my double-glazed door so hard to lock?
Problem locking is typically brought on by thermal expansion (doors expanding in heat) or sagging hinges, which pull the locking points out of positioning with the frame keeps. Changing the hinges typically resolves this concern. If the crucial turns stiffly, the locking mechanism itself may need lubrication or replacement.
